Output d2917d056e413db434cc3aa737e7de316757c65c482ba470ba3e12aeab077d95:1

value
453380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c58b86defc5aa7fdf3935efcb994d556b2c1f9fa OP_EQUAL
address
3KhYBq3Vp3aEgoZcn2mAXNV9ufnbTkk1D7
transaction
d2917d056e413db434cc3aa737e7de316757c65c482ba470ba3e12aeab077d95
confirmations
324740
spent
true